Albula. Korn takes this to be the tributary of the Anio so named, the outlet of the Aquae Albulae, but it may be the Tiber under its earlier name (cf. 616 n.), as it is wherever else the name occurs in Ovid, Fast.II. 389 Fast., IV. 68 and V. 646.Numici, sc. aquae. Cf. 579 n.
